How to Connect Cricut to Computer: A Comprehensive Guide
Connecting your Cricut machine to your computer is an essential step in unleashing your creativity. Whether you’re a seasoned crafter or just starting out, this guide will provide you with the necessary instructions to establish a seamless connection.
Step 1: Gather Your Materials
- Cricut machine
- USB cable
- Computer
Step 2: Download the Cricut Design Space Software
Visit the Cricut website to download the free Cricut Design Space software. This software is necessary to operate your Cricut machine and connect it to your computer.
Step 3: Connect the Cricut Machine to Your Computer
Using the USB cable, connect the Cricut machine to an available USB port on your computer. Ensure that the cable is securely plugged into both the machine and the computer.
Step 4: Turn on the Cricut Machine
Press the power button on the Cricut machine to turn it on. The machine will initialize and establish a connection with your computer.
Step 5: Launch the Cricut Design Space Software
Once the Cricut machine is connected, launch the Cricut Design Space software. The software will automatically detect the connected machine and establish a connection.
Step 6: Verify the Connection
To verify that the connection is successful, check the bottom left corner of the Design Space software. You should see the status of the connection, which should indicate “Connected”.
Troubleshooting Tips
- Ensure that the USB cable is securely connected to both the Cricut machine and the computer.
- Try using a different USB port on your computer.
- Restart your Cricut machine and computer.
- Check for updated software from the Cricut website.
- Contact Cricut customer support for assistance.
